Additional Information;

 

The Senior Licensing Officer advised Members that there are currently two existing Premise Licences in place which would be surrendered should the new application for a Premise Licence be granted.

 

The new Premise Licence would consolidate the two existing licences and conditions with the addition of two outdoor events per year.

 

The Public Protection Officer advised Members that before the large events the operator would have to apply and hold a Special Safety Certificate.  The certificate must be approved and granted prior to a large event and will state conditions that must be complied with.

 

The Public Safety Advisory Group (PSAG) is the approving authority and will request the club submits an Event Safety Plan before any large event.

 

Decision:

 

That the application for Premises Licence in respect of Torquay United Football Club, Plainmoor, Torquay. TQ1 3PS be granted as applied for, with the addition of the following conditions;

 

1.    At times when the neighbouring school is closed, the premises designated smoking area shall be located in Homelands Lane.

 

During the two outdoor events taking place the following conditions shall apply;

 

1.    The event shall have a wind down period to allow for public dispersal. Marshalls/Stewards shall control and advise the public to leave the site quickly and quietly.

 

2.    The Designated Organiser shall ensure that announcements are broadcast by loudspeaker system at closing requesting that patrons co-operate in leaving the premises and vicinity as quickly and quietly as possible.

 

3.     Construction and deconstruction of the fencing, staged area and units ancillary to the event shall not be carried out between the hours of 23.00 and 08.00 hours to minimise disturbance to residents.

 

4.    The organiser shall liaise with Environmental Health regarding environmental regulations, noise levels. Council Officers if in attendance shall monitor noise level and have contact with stage control.
